Ultrasonic liquid level indication circuit diagram composed of NE555
Source: InternetPublisher:李商隐身 Keywords: NE555 circuit diagram ultrasonic routing Updated: 2021/08/31
The figure shows the ultrasonic liquid level indicating circuit composed of NE555 . The circuit consists of an ultrasonic transmitting circuit and a receiving circuit.
The ultrasonic transmitting circuit consists of 555, R1, W1, C1 and ultrasonic transmitting head UCM40T. The ultrasonic receiving circuit consists of a receiving head UCM40R that matches the transmitting head, cascade amplifiers BG1 and BG2, and a detection circuit. When the liquid level is close to the receiving head, the deflection angle of the voltmeter increases, and the closer the liquid level is, the greater the corresponding deflection angle is.
Since ultrasonic waves are not affected by the concentration and conductivity of the liquid being measured, this circuit is superior to the general contact liquid level display circuit and has higher accuracy.
